Iran, EU3 set to begin nuclear talks in Turkey
The representatives of Iran and the P5+1 countries pose for a picture during their meeting in Vienna, Austria, November 24, 2014. (AFP photo)/ Representatives from Iran and three big European Union countries involved in negotiations on Tehran’s nuclear program are set to hold a fresh round of nuclear talks. The Islamic Republic and the EU three -- France, Germany and the United Kingdom -- will start the one-day talks in the Turkish city of Istanbul later on Thursday.
